Webb24 sep. 2024 · Minute pirate bugs can easily be confused with bed bugs, who are also very small and actively bite people during summer and fall. At a glance, these insects can look similar in their nymph stage, but in reality pirate bugs are much smaller than bed bugs. Pirate nymphs are 0.2 – 0.5mm long, and bed bug nymphs can be up to 2mm long. WebbSpiders deposit their egg sacs in the thin gaps in hard surfaces like walls and furniture. Springtails are one of the little jumping bugs in bed that can enter your bedroom through the open windows and land on your bed. Springtails are minute bugs that grow only up to 0.2 mm or 0.008 inches in size. They come in different colors, ...
